>>>
>>>
>>> We are making circles... This was before and I commented already it is
>>> wrong. You cannot have some unknown/random properties in "required:"
>>> without describing them in "properties:". Please list all your
>>> properties in "properties:", except the ones coming from snps
>>> bindings/schema.
>>>
>> 
>> I missed that when adding new items to "required",
>> it should also be added to "properties".
>> I will add the following items to the property.
>> 
>> samsung,fsys-sysreg:
>>   description:
>>     Phandle to system register of fsys block.
>>   $ref: /schemas/types.yaml#/definitions/phandle
>
> This is ok.
>
>> 
>> samsung,syscon-phandle:
>>   description:
>>     Phandle to the PMU system controller node.
>>   $ref: /schemas/types.yaml#/definitions/phandle
>
> This is ok.
>
>> 
>> samsung,syscon-bus-s-fsys:
>>   description:
>>     Phandle to bus-s path of fsys block, this register
>>     are used for enabling bus-s.
>>   $ref: /schemas/types.yaml#/definitions/phandle
>> 
>> samsung,syscon-bus-p-fsys:
>>   description:
>>     Phandle to bus-p path of fsys block, this register
>>     are used for enabling bus-p.
>>   $ref: /schemas/types.yaml#/definitions/phandle
>
> This two look unspecific and hacky workaround for missing drivers. Looks
> like instead of implementing interconnect or clock driver, you decided
> to poke some other registers. Why this cannot be an interconnect driver?
>
>

bus-s, bus-p is a register that exists in the sysreg of the fsys block.
It is the same block as "fsys-sysreg" but is separated separately in
hardware.
So, get resource is performed separately from "fsys-sysreg".
They set pcie slave, dbi related control settings,
naming "bus-x" seems to be interconnect.
I will add this description to property.
I don't think it need to use the interconnect driver,
so please let me know your opinion.
